Make Muscle Now - But, Here Are 4 Mistakes You Must Avoid

Maybe youre the proverbial hard gainer and have been working out for years to make muscle. On the other hand, you may have just started trying to build a massive physique. Either way, youre trying to achieve the same thing; you want to make muscle grow to the point youre sporting massively ripped quads, huge arms, and shoulders thatll fill an open barn door. Youve seen pictures. You know it can be done. Hell, maybe youve even seen guys in your gym that are hoisting the tonnage youd like to.

Its no secret. Your muscles respond to overload using ancient, primeval forces that literally force them to grow. Its an adaptive response that your body uses to ensure survival. If its confronted with something it cant handle, it responds by increasing muscle size and strength in an attempt to overcome adversity. The key to making muscle is to make your body face the challenges that will initiate these internal changes. The most effective way to accomplish this is to incorporate some form of resistance training.

You cant just go about it willy nilly, however. Sure, at the beginning, almost anything you do will be almost guaranteed to produce some results. Early on, you can get away with almost anything and still make impressive gains. Why start that way though? There are certainly some mistakes you need to avoid, lest you keep yourself from making the muscle you should be. If you want to maximize your results, and your muscle mass, here are some things to avoid.

1 Overtraining. This is probably the most common training error for those attempting to build muscle. Its understandable, really. People get excited and want to pack on as much rock hard mass as possible. Unfortunately, more isnt better when it comes to weight training. Like anything else, balance is essential. Youve got to balance your desire to make muscle with your bodys ability to recover. The recovery period is when you actually make your muscles grow. If you train too hard, youll not give your body the time it needs to recover and get stronger.

2 Not enough sleep You dont gain mass when youre training. No, your muscles actually grow when youre sleeping. Thats when recovery takes place and you start making progress. Insufficient sleep will definitely stymie your efforts to make muscle. Try to get at least 7 hours a night if possible. If youre older, you may need even more.

3 Concentrating too much on too few body parts. When it comes to making muscle, youve got to spread the wealth. Ever had a friend who was built like a kite? A huge upper body with beanpole legs is a common look among those who train this way. Yeah, they may have a great set of guns, but if their back and legs have been neglected, it can take months or years to bring everything back so they have symmetrical muscle development. Dont overemphasize certain body parts at the expense of others. Youll regret it later, if you ever figure it out. If you dont figure it out, youll be the butt of many jokes behind your back.

4 Poor nutrition Its like this. You cant eat like crap and expect to maximize your muscular gains. Not only is poor nutrition bad for your overall health, you can expect to languish in obscurity if your subject your body to the abuse the wrong diet. You dont need to actually go on a diet, and you dont need to overload on expensive supplements either, although you may benefit from a few well selected supplements. You need enough protein to feed those muscles youre trying to build. If youre training hard for muscular gains, youll need more than if you are running a marathon or sitting on your fat behind. You also need plenty of carbs to fuel those brutal workouts. Make sure youre using good, complex carbs for energy, not processed sugars and flour products. Dont cut the fat altogether, either. You need it for things such as proper brain function. In addition, you can trick the body into storing fat by eliminating too much fat from your diet.

Avoiding these four mistakes, combined with the correct training program will make muscle like you never dreamed possible. Letting even one of these creep in however, can halt your progress in its tracks.
